Historically, September has been the worst month for stocks, with the S&P 500 averaging negative returns since 1928. To navigate this period, investors are looking at three actively managed funds: iShares U.S. Large Cap Premium Income Active ETF (BALI), Amplify CWP Enhanced Dividend Income ETF (DIVO), and Janus Henderson AAA CLO ETF (JAAA). BALI and DIVO use options overlays on large-cap portfolios to generate high-single-digit yields, while JAAA invests in AAA CLO tranches, offering around 5% in floating-rate yield with low stock market sensitivity.
